Why is GPSR compliance important?

  1. Mandatory for selling in the EU – Non-compliance can result in product removal, fines, or legal actions.

  2. Increased accountability – Marketplaces like Amazon now require sellers to provide transparent safety documentation.

  3. Enhanced consumer trust – Compliance builds brand credibility and increases your sales potential in EU markets.
